Structural and Biochemical Characterization of Poly-ADP-ribose Polymerase from Trypanosoma brucei
Abstract Trypanosoma brucei is a unicellular parasite responsible for African trypanosomiasis or sleeping sickness. It contains a single PARP enzyme opposed to many higher eukaryotes, which have numerous PARPs. PARPs are responsible for a post-translational modification, ADP-ribosylation, regulating...
